Bloodborne Enters Several Days of “Emergency Maintenance”

Bloodborne just received its first expansion pack in the form of The Old Hunters. It's been enough to increase the population to figures similar to the game's original launch, but this week's emergency maintenance will challenge its surge of popularity.

FromSoftware has confirmed that Bloodborne's servers are currently under maintenance. The maintenance was published in Japanese on its official website, which shares that the maintenance is expected to take a "few days." There is no explanation for why this is happening, but many are suggesting that it's to fix the free DLC exploit which allowed players to obtain the content without purchase.

During this time, features such as co-op, messaging, and PvP won't be available.

For players who rely on co-op to take down the harsh bosses in Bloodborne, this maintenance has invoked frustration. On the plus side, invasions are impossible.
